Pushilin reported on the stabilization of the situation in the Red Army area


The situation in the Red Army area, where the Armed Forces of Ukraine (AFU) deployed reserves from Kursk, has been stabilized. This was announced on March 16 by the head of the Donetsk People's Republic (DPR) Denis Pushilin.
According to him, the Ukrainian militants have set themselves the task of keeping the units of the Russian Armed Forces (AF) as long as possible.
"Nevertheless, even though the enemy has deployed additional reserves from the Kursk direction, our units are managing to stabilize the situation and move forward," he said in a video message on the Telegram channel.
Pushilin also noted the advance of the Russian army in the Seversky and Krasnolimansky directions.
On February 24, the head of the DPR pointed to the advance of the Russian Armed Forces units along the entire front line, calling it characteristic. He emphasized the successes in the Kurakhovo-Novoselovsky area, where the Russian military eliminated the "pocket" after the liberation of Ulakly. Then Pushilin clarified that the Ukrainian Armed Forces were trying to counterattack in the Red Army area, but their efforts were not successful.
